5 ROUNDING OUT 2013 Tuesday marks the end of the 2013 calender year and Northern Illinois women s basketball s non-conference schedule. NIU is looking to close it on a high note when hosts downtown rival Illinois-Chicago. New Year s Eve tipoff with UIC is set for 1 p.m. at the NIU Convocation Center. THE HUSKIES AND THE FLAMES The New Year s Eve bash between NIU and UIC will be 43rd meeting all-time between the two schools. Northern Illinois owns a advantage in the series and is 2-1 in the last three meetings at the Convocation Center. In the last three matchups, NIU is 0-3 but has only been outscored by the Flames by an average of four points (55-51). LAST TIME OUT The Huskies hosted Northern Iowa December 21 in their first home game at the NIU Convocation Center in exactly one month. NIU led for 39:46 of the regulation 40 minutes but a backdoor, baseline layup by the Panthers with 2.7 seconds left sunk Northern Illinois, The Huskies held a seven point advantage at halftime, 32-25, and would go on to lead by as much as 11 points in the period. While NIU shot 27-of-56 (.482) from the field, it was UNI s 10-of-26 (.385) clip from behind three point line that aided the Panthers comeback. Northern Illinois would outscore Northern Iowa in the paint, Three Huskies reached double-figures in scoring with Amanda Corral pacing NIU at 18 points, 12 of which occurred in the second half. Freshman Jazmine Harris had her first career doubledigit effort with 15 points, reaching the mark in 19 minutes. Redshirt junior Danny Pulliam scored 12 points, the fourth time this season she scored 10-or-more points this year. SCOUTING THE FLAMES Illinois-Chicago has had a terrific run of form lately as it is 9-2 this season, winning its last nine games. UIC s last loss occurred November 10 at Northwestern, 79-63, and since then, the Flames have outscored their opponents, 72-63, in their undefeated streak. Amongst those victories was a triumph at Wisconsin December 21 at the Kohl Center, whom the Huskies lost to on November 17. Six of UIC s wins have occurred on the road or on neutral sites. Rachel Story has been the Flames top-scorer, averaging 20.7 points per game in her nine appearances this season. Ruvanna Campbell and Katie Hannemann are also scoring big for UIC as they average 14.0 and 13.5 points, respectively. In her 11 starts this season, Campell is averaging a double-double per game as she is also rebounding at a clip of 10.8 per game, a big factor for the Flames +8.5 rebounding margin. From the field, Illinois-Chicago is shooting.407 but is allowing its opponents to shoot.390. Averaging 20 trips to the free throw line per game, the Flames are shooting.669 as a team from the charity stripe. NEW YEAR S EVE HISTORY LESSON Tuesday afternoon s matinee will be the Huskies sixth contest alltime on New Year s Eve and NIU s first since 2011, a loss at DePaul. All-time, Northern Illinois is 3-2 on New Year s Eve and last earned victory in 1995 when the Huskies defeated Michigan at Chick Evans Fieldhouse, NIU also earned victories over Dartmouth (1988, 94-86) and against Iowa (1983, 69-65) on New Year s Eve. 6 LAST MEETING WITH THE FLAMES Northern Illinois and UIC squared off December 22, 2012 at the UIC Pavillion in the Chicago Loop. The Huskies jumped out as the aggressor as they took a lead at the half, but the Flames tied it up at the end of regulation, 57-57, to force overtime. UIC would go on to outscore NIU in the extra period, 9-4, to defeat Northern Illinois, The Flames accounted for 22 points at the free throw line, making 22-of-30 (.733) attempts. THE FLAMES COOL IN DeKALB Northern Illinois has had a lot of success against Illinois-Chicago in DeKalb over the course of the series history as the Huskies are 17-7 all-time at home against the Flames. The Convocation Center s confines have been quite friendly for NIU against UIC since its doors opened in 2003, as Northern Illinois is 3-1 versus the Flames. JAZ FUSION While also an eclectic offshoot of the popular style of music, freshman Jazmine Harris has seemed to put a few pieces of the college game puzzle together as she has improved her play week-to-week. While only playing 19 minutes in the Huskies last game versus Northern Iowa December 22, Harris accumulated a career-high 15 points as she slashed her way to a 6-for-10 (.600) performance. She also grabbed five rebounds and was 3-for-4 at the free throw line. At Wisconsin, her home state no less, the frosh finished 4-for-8 from the field to acount for eight points with two rebounds and a steal in quick spell minutes during the first and second half. On Nov. 21 versus Bradley, Harris scored four points and registered her first career assist, dishing two against the Braves. In the win over Lamar, Harris scored five points and pulled down six rebounds in the effort. CAP AND GOWN After finishing her last final Tuesday December 10, redshirt junior Danny Pulliam completed her Bachelor s of Science degree from Northern Illinois University in family and individual development. Pulliam walked across the stage Sunday, December 15 at the NIU Convocation Center and will start graduate school this January to begin working on a Master s degree in Sports Management at Northern Illinois. A LITTLE HELP FROM MY FRIENDS The five players on the floor for Northern Illinois have had no problem sharing the ball to find the most high-percentage shots. The Huskies have totaled 97 assists through nine games, averaging 10.8 helpers a game. Five times this season, NIU has gone over double-digit in assists, peaked by a 16 assist effort versus Lamar in the Aggie Hotel Encanto Thanksgiving Classic November 30 at New Mexico State. It was the most assists by the Huskies since a 19 assist effort at Ohio University February 6, AUGUSTA: THE DOUBLE-DOUBLE MACHINE Through nine games, junior forward Natecia Augusta has three double-doubles this season. Augusta entered with no such performances in her career but has proven to be strong presence in the post for Northern Illinois this year. The Peoria, Ill. native has registered the feat twice at home and recorded her first road double-double at New Mexico State, her last such performance, with a 10 point, 12 rebound effort against the Aggies. On the season, Augusta is averaging 10.0 points and 6.7 rebounds per contest to pace the Huskies in rebounding. She is second on the team in scoring. MONEY OFF THE BENCH Senior Ashley Sneed has been just the answer the Huskies are looking for off the bench, averaging 15.0 minutes and 4.7 points per game. While the numbers might look average, Sneed is shooting an extremely impressive.553 from the field (21-for-38) to lead Northern Illinois in that category. What makes the mark that much more impressive is the fact that she has made most of her baskets as a shooter, not as a slasher. DIME DISHER While Pulliam has found a groove scoring as of late, she never lost her ability to distribute the ball, despite missing most of the last two seasons with injury. The junior is averaging 3.1 assists per game this season and has recorded at least four assists in five games, including four of the last six games. SOME PERSPECTIVE ON PULLIAM Through nine games, Danny Pulliam has 28 assists, an average of 3.1 per game. The previous two seasons, Pulliam only made a total of 12 appearances and combined for 24 assists, averaging 2.0 per game. As a freshman in , the Indianapolis, Ind. native played in 30 games and registered 61 dimes (2.1 APG). SHAKING THE DUST OFF Due to a series of injuries over the last two seasons, redshirt junior Danny Pulliam has played in 46 games as a Huskie, 30 of which came as freshman. In only her 13th career appearance, Pulliam scored in double-digits for the first time, a career-high 15 points versus Illinois State. 32 games, three seasons, one meniscus tear and a microfracture surgery later, Pulliam reached double figures again as she dropped 11 points at Wisconsin Nov. 17, nine of which came in the second half. A NUGGET ON NINEVEH, INDIANA Did you know that the school used in the movie Hoosiers was located in Nineveh, Ind., the hometown of NIU freshman guard Ally Lehman? According to IMDB.com, the exterior of the ficticious Hickory High School was actually Nineveh Elementary School. HUSKIES SIGN THREE FOR The Northern Illinois women s basketball program signed three players to National Letters of Intent for the school year Tuesday as the Huskies signed three players from the state of Wisconsin. NIU added guard Georgia Breunig (Sauk Prairie, Wis./ Sauk Prairie), and combo guards/forwards Renee Sladek (Merrill, Wis./Merrill) and Kelly Smith (Hartland, Wis./Arrowhead). It is the fourth recruiting class for Head Coach Kathi Bennett at NIU. I m very excited about all three of these players and their addition to our program, Bennett said. All three of these players understand the game of basketball and have a high basketball IQ, so we re excited have them next season. WELCOME BACK Redshirt junior Danny Pulliam returned to the Northern Illinois squad Friday at Green Bay after only appearing in seven contests during due to complications from a meniscus tear and microfracture surgery in that only allowed her to play in five games that season. In 26 minutes off the bench at Green Bay, the point guard from Indianapolis, Ind. accounted for four assists, four rebounds, two steals and a block. In her seven games last season, Pulliam accounted for almost 20 percent of NIU s assists when she was on the floor. BACK IN HER COMFORT ZONE After spending time the last two seasons at point guard, junior Amanda Corral is back at her natural position of shooting guard. Injuries at various points over the last two seasons forced Corral to run the point. Despite being out of position, she averaged 12.7 points per game and 2.1 assists per game in AN ALL AROUND PLAYER Amanda Corral led the Huskies in points, rebounds and assists per game last season, only one-of-two players in the Mid-American Conference last season to do so and is the only returning player in the MAC to accomplish that feat in She averaged 12.7 points, 5.0 rebounds and 2.1 helpers per game. Kent State s Tamzin Barroilhet also led her team in the aforementioned categories last season. DUMOULIN S IMPACT OFF THE BENCH Junior Natecia Augusta started in the post for the Huskies in the opener at Green Bay, but unfortunately found herself in foul trouble early in the game, and eventually, fouled out of the contest in the second half. Classmate Alex Dumoulin stepped in for Augusta in the post and collected eight points, three rebounds, two steals and one block in the effort. What makes her performance so remarkable was the fact that she had only practiced on Thursday that week as she had just been cleared for practice due to a hand injury, suffered early during the preseason. In six games, she has averaged 4.3 points and 3.2 rebounds per game in the post, providing quality minutes for other posts players to take a breather. MEET ALEX DUMOULIN Junior transfer Alex Dumoulin is used to being a member of a team as she is one of 10 children in her family, six girls and four boys. Dumoulin grew up playing basketball with her siblings and other children that worked on the family farm in Hampshire, Ill. The forward was an all-american at Elgin Community College and grew up playing on the same team with her older sister, Cassie, who also played basketball at Elgin and was an all-american. She went on to play at Illinois. HUSKIES ON THE DEFENSIVE Despite their 7-23 record in , the Huskies and their famed pack defense were fourth in the MAC last season in scoring defense as NIU allowed 59.5 points per game. A TRANSFORMATION IN THE POST Junior Natecia Augusta made big strides last season in her game, improving her scoring from 3.9 points as a freshman to 6.2 points as a sophomore. After a busy summer in the weight room to improve her strength and fitness, Augusta will be looked upon to take bigger role in the post in HOT AUGUSTA NIGHTS Last season, Natecia Augusta led the Huskies in field goal percentage with a clip of.528 on 127 total shots. Not only strong from the field, the then-sophomore also produced at the free throw line with a.789 mark. She twice went eighth-for-eight at the charity stripe last season, and also produced eight flawless games from the line. She scored six times in the post versus Lewis in exhibition play, closing the day with 13 points. WELCOMED ADDITIONS Over the summer, the Huskies added two new assistant coaches in Debbie Whitman and Latrell Fleming. Whitman, a member of the Northern Illinois Athletics Hall of Fame, was promoted to assistant status after spending last season as the team s Director of Basketball Operations. Fleming came to NIU after spending a year at UW-Milwaukee. Also new in is Graduate Assistant Anya Covington, who played four seasons at Wisconsin, her last two as team captain, before playing a year in Germany for the Rhein Main Baskets. THORP - A JACK OF ALL TRADES Over the last three seasons in the Northern Illinois program, redshirt junior Jenna Thorp has developed into a do it all forward for the Huskies. After averaging 4.3 points and 3.8 rebounds per game in , Thorp improved her numbers last season to

11 points and 4.8 rebounds per game. The Hinckley native doubled her assist output as well, increasing from 22 helpers to 53. She also became a threat behind the three point line, shooting 15-for- 44 (.341) in , compared to 2-for-6 (.333) as a freshman. 12 Kathi Bennett Head Coach Fourth season at NIU (38-62) 21st season overall ( ) Kathi Bennett, a veteran collegiate head coach who has guided three programs to eight NCAA Tournaments and five conference championships while posting a career winning percentage of.585 ( ), was named head women s basketball coach at Northern Illinois University, May , and has already received a contract extension through the 2017 season. Through three seasons, Bennett owns a record with the Huskies. In the first two seasons under her guidance, the Huskies went from a 10-win team in to a 13-win team in , despite losing three starters. More importantly, NIU improved from a 4-12 record in Mid-American Conference play to a 7-9 mark in the season. In , Bennett directed a youthful roster of nine underclassmen to the MAC quarterfinals for the first time since 2007 with a record, 6-10 in MAC play. The splash in the MAC postseason marked the Huskies first trip to Cleveland since 2009 and first win in the MAC Tournament since NIU s last second victory over Akron in the tournament landed the Huskies on the front page of the NCAA s Women s Basketball page. For their success, the Huskies were invited to play in the Preseason WNIT, where they opened the season at Iowa. Though NIU lost to the Hawkeyes, Northern Illinois would go on to win two-consecutive games in the tournament to finish 2-1. Showing the principles of Bennett s famed pack defense, the Huskies ranked in the top four in the league in scoring defense with a clip of 59.5, opponent field goal percentage, opponent three-point percentage and defensive rebounding. NIU also ranked 57th in the country in free throw percentage. Bennett, who earned her 300th career win with NIU to join her father, legendary coach Dick Bennett, on the 300-career-win list, came to NIU after two seasons as an assistant coach at Wisconsin, where she coached the Badgers defense and was instrumental in UW making its first NCAA Tournament appearance in eight years in Wisconsin finished tied for third in the league and led the Big Ten in scoring defense in 2010 after ranking 10th in the league in that category prior to her arrival. A native of Stevens Point, Wis., Bennett is the sister of University of Virginia head men s basketball coach Tony Bennett; her father won 316 games as a collegiate coach at Washington State, Wisconsin, UW-Green Bay and UW-Stevens Point. Kathi played collegiately at both Stevens Point and Green Bay and earned her bachelor s degree from UW-Green Bay in Kathi Bennett s Career Head Coaching Record ABOUT BENNETT Year school w-l Pct.
